3D Viewer is an essential tool for both professionals and hobbyists alike. It is designed to allow users to visualize 3D models and objects in a 3D environment. With the 3D Viewer, users can interact with 3D objects, analyze their shape and structure, and manipulate them in a variety of ways.
The Autodesk 3D Viewer allows users to easily and quickly view 3D models in a variety of formats from any web browser.

The technical requirements for a 3D Viewer software will depend on the specific features and functions of the tool. Generally, 3D Viewer software requires a compatible operating system, such as Windows, Mac OS or Linux, along with a CPU with sufficient processing power, such as an Intel Core i7 or similar. The software may also require a compatible graphics card and/or dedicated GPU with support for OpenGL or similar 3D rendering technologies, along with sufficient RAM and storage space. Additionally, for some 3D Viewer software, an Internet connection may be required for certain features.
